Qt开发新纪元:智能化工具助力高效编程

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

标题:Qt开发新纪元:智能化工具助力高效编程

在当今快速发展的软件开发领域,Qt作为一款跨平台的C++图形用户界面库,以其灵活性和强大的功能,成为了众多开发者的心头好。然而,随着项目复杂度的增加,如何提高开发效率、减少重复劳动,成为了一个亟待解决的问题。幸运的是,新一代智能化工具的出现为Qt开发者带来了福音。本文将探讨如何利用这些智能工具,特别是通过引入AI技术,让Qt开发变得更加轻松高效。

一、Qt开发面临的挑战

对于许多Qt开发者来说,编写复杂的UI逻辑、处理多线程任务以及调试代码都是日常工作中常见的难题。传统的开发方式往往需要大量的时间和精力来确保代码的正确性和性能优化。特别是在大型项目中,手动编写和维护代码不仅耗时,而且容易出错。此外,新手开发者在面对复杂的Qt框架时,常常感到无从下手,这进一步增加了学习曲线。

二、智能化工具的崛起

近年来,随着人工智能(AI)技术的发展,越来越多的智能化工具开始应用于软件开发领域。这些工具通过集成AI算法,能够帮助开发者更高效地完成编程任务。其中,InsCode AI IDE作为一个创新性的IDE产品,凭借其强大的AI功能,正在改变Qt开发的面貌。

三、InsCode AI IDE的应用场景
1. 自动化代码生成

在Qt开发中,创建复杂的UI界面和处理事件响应是必不可少的任务。通过InsCode AI IDE,开发者只需输入自然语言描述,即可自动生成相应的代码片段。例如,描述一个带有按钮和文本框的窗口布局,InsCode AI IDE会立即生成对应的Qt代码,并自动配置相关属性。这种自动化代码生成功能大大减少了手动编写代码的时间,使开发者能够专注于业务逻辑的设计。

2. 智能代码补全与优化

编写高质量的Qt代码不仅需要熟练掌握语法,还需要不断优化性能。InsCode AI IDE内置的智能代码补全功能可以在开发者输入代码时提供实时建议,确保代码的准确性和一致性。此外,它还能分析代码结构,识别潜在的性能瓶颈,并给出优化建议。比如,在处理大量数据时,InsCode AI IDE可以推荐使用更高效的算法或数据结构,从而提升程序运行效率。

3. 快速调试与错误修复

调试是Qt开发过程中不可或缺的一环。InsCode AI IDE提供了交互式调试器,支持逐步执行、变量检查和调用堆栈查看等功能,帮助开发者迅速定位并解决问题。更重要的是,当遇到难以捉摸的Bug时,开发者可以将错误信息反馈给AI助手,由AI助手进行分析并提出解决方案。这种智能调试机制显著缩短了开发周期,提高了项目的成功率。

4. 文档生成与注释添加

良好的文档和注释是高质量代码的重要组成部分。InsCode AI IDE具备快速解释代码的能力,能够帮助开发者理解现有代码的逻辑。同时,它还支持自动生成详细的注释,无论是中文还是英文,都可以根据需求灵活切换。这一特性使得团队协作更加顺畅,新人也能更快地上手项目。

四、InsCode AI IDE的巨大价值
1. 提高开发效率

借助InsCode AI IDE的强大功能,Qt开发者可以在短时间内完成更多的任务。无论是从零开始构建新项目,还是对现有项目进行维护和扩展,都能享受到显著的速度提升。这意味着开发者可以将更多的时间投入到创新和优化上,而不是被繁琐的编码工作所束缚。

2. 降低学习门槛

对于初学者而言,Qt的学习曲线相对较高。然而,有了InsCode AI IDE的帮助,即使是没有任何编程经验的新手也能够快速上手。通过简单的对话式交互,他们可以轻松生成所需的代码,并逐步掌握Qt的核心概念和技术。这无疑为更多人打开了进入Qt开发世界的大门。

3. 增强团队协作

在一个团队中,不同成员的技术水平可能存在差异。InsCode AI IDE提供的标准化代码生成和统一的开发环境,有助于缩小这种差距。所有成员都可以基于相同的模板和规范进行开发,减少了沟通成本和误解的可能性。同时,智能问答和文档生成功能也为团队内部的知识共享提供了便利。

五、结语

总之,InsCode AI IDE作为一款集成了先进AI技术的IDE产品,为Qt开发带来了前所未有的便利和效率。它不仅能够简化复杂的编码任务,还能帮助开发者更好地理解和优化代码。无论你是经验丰富的资深工程师,还是刚刚踏入编程领域的新人,InsCode AI IDE都将成为你不可或缺的好帮手。如果你还没有尝试过这款神奇的工具,不妨现在就下载体验一下吧!相信你会爱上这个充满智慧的编程伙伴。

点击下载InsCode AI IDE


希望这篇文章能够帮助读者更好地了解Qt开发中的智能化工具应用,并激发他们对InsCode AI IDE的兴趣。如果你有任何疑问或建议,请随时留言交流。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_066

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值